Yeditepe University Confucius Institute Opened

Yeditepe University opened the 4th Confucius Institute in Turkey with the participation of YU Hongyang, Ambassador of the People's Republic of China, and Bedrettin Dalan, Founder and Honorary President of Yeditepe University

The opening ceremony of the Yeditepe University Confucius Institute was held on Wednesday, September 27 at the Faculty of Fine Arts Conference Hall.

"Cooperation Will Increase"
Yeditepe University Rector Prof. Dr. Canan Aykut Bingöl also reminded that Yeditepe University has been teaching Chinese since 2008 and said that the cooperation between the two countries' universities has been gaining strength for 10 years. Expressing that the opening of the Confucius Institute is an attempt to crown these efforts, Bingöl said, "Confucius Institutes are very important centers that increase the cooperation of universities, students and societies in both countries. As the two societies that formed the Silk Road for years, we hope to continue strengthening these relations."

"Wisemen walk in the same direction"
YU Hongyang, Ambassador of the People's Republic of China, expressed happiness that the fourth Confucius Institute of Turkey opened at Yeditepe University, which educates young people who are open to development, innovation and secularism based on Atatürk's principles. YU Hongyang said "The countries on both sides of the Asian continent, China and Turkey, are continuing their friendship and cooperation which started with the Silk Road."

Prof. Dr. YANG Kexin, Vice Rector of Nankai University, said that the foundation of Confucius Institute will be a bridge for education, culture, trade and economic cooperation between the two countries.

The Consul General of the People's Republic of China, QIAN Bo, also read a message of congratulation sent by HANBAN.

At the opening ceremony Bedrettin Dalan, Founding and Honorary President of Yeditepe University, gave a plaque of thanks to the Ambassador of the People's Republic of China, YU Hongyang, and QIAN Bo, the Consul General of the People's Republic of China. The exhibition "Friendship Connected by the Silk Road" was also visited by all in attendance.
